Note: The job is a remote job and is open to candidates in USA. Stratolaunch is a technology accelerator focused on hypersonic testing and innovation for national security. The Program Finance Analyst will provide financial oversight, analysis, and reporting for various programs, collaborating closely with the program team to influence decision-making and ensure effective budget management.
Responsibilities
- Contribute to program cost forecast and budget management
- Keep the program team current regarding its upcoming activities, deadlines, and milestones
- Perform schedule-based risk analysis on the company’s projects
- Help evaluate risks and risk mitigation plans to determine if the risks are appropriate and risk mitigations are adequate
- Produce and review ad-hoc project-level projections, graphs, and reports for both internal/external stakeholders
- Perform analysis and prepare reports to ensure contracts are within negotiated and agreed-upon parameters and government cost control guidelines
- Sets up cost control system, monitors and controls costs and schedules on contracts requiring validated cost schedule control system
- Support audits and reviews requests from programs, customers, and company management, fact-finding and negotiation support
- Ensures adequate funding availability by maintaining accurate records of expenditures, directing preparation of expenditure projections, and submitting timely requests for additional funding to the government
- Support the preparation and coordination of financial forecasting and reporting, Annual Operating Plan and Resource Plan
- Streamline data collection, modeling, and management practices
- Contribute Financial information to the monthly program review
- Support the preparation of business proposals to the US Government and industry
- Support compliance with contractual requirements and internal procedures
- Support preparation invoices, familiarity with CPFF, T&M and FFP contracts is preferred
- Understanding of EVMS and government CPR reporting a plus
